At least ten people died and a few others were injured after a car rammed a trailer truck from behind in Nadiad at the Ahmedabad-Vadodara Expressway on Wednesday.
The incident occurred when the Ertiga car, en route from Vadodara to Ahmedabad, veered off behind a trailer truck.
As per the latest information, all 10 occupants of the car lost their lives in the accident. While eight of them died on the spot, 2 succumbed to their injuries while being transported to the hospital, police said.
One other person injured in the accident is in critical condition and has been admitted to the hospital.
Soon after the accident was reported, two ambulances were rushed to the spot, along with the Express Highway patrolling team, police said.
There is a jam on the express highway due to an accident.
